The differences between audit partners and quality assurance auditors can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, an audit partner has an average salary of $195,691, which is higher than the $77,535 average annual salary of a quality assurance auditor.
The top three skills for an audit partner include client service, CPA and client relationships. The most important skills for a quality assurance auditor are patients, ISO, and clinical trials.
| Audit Partner | Quality Assurance Auditor | |
| Yearly salary | $195,691 | $77,535 |
| Hourly rate | $94.08 | $37.28 |
| Growth rate | 6% | 6% |
| Number of jobs | 33,597 | 79,931 |
| Job satisfaction | - | - |
| Most common degree | Bachelor's Degree, 81% | Bachelor's Degree, 55% |
| Average age | 44 | 44 |
| Years of experience | - | - |
